Code Name: Blondie by Christina Skye

Miki Fortune started out her day taking pictures of sexy models for a South Seas Islands calendar. But before nightfall, she was stranded on a deserted island, in the path of a hurricane with a Navy Seal who thinks she’s working for an international criminal, Cruz. Max Preston believes the gorgeous blonde is lying when she denies working with Cruz as nothing else would explain her presence here. Even his enhanced senses tell him she’s innocent. With time running out, can Miki convince Max of her innocence or will Max be forced to neutralize Miki so he can complete his mission?

Okay. I’ll admit it. I’m hooked on Christina’s Code Name books. In Code Name: Blondie, she manages to weave romance and danger the way few other authors can manage. As usual, Christina manages to push the edge of science fiction in her books with her enhanced characters. I love the way she managed the sexual tension between Miki and Max. The only downside to this book is that you really need to read Code Name: Baby and Code Name: Princes to really understand where this story begins. But I don’t consider that a real hardship :) .

Details: HQN, May 2006

Bottom line: A great book
